Game Updates:

  1. Fixed incorrect classification of Axe Spirits, which caused Axe Spirits to appear erroneously during Summon

  2. The "HP Up" buff is now a separate multiplier category

  3. Fixed typos in some character and enemy data that caused abilities to not take effect

  4. The status bar is now limited to 3 rows in height; overflow content can be scrolled.

Editor Updates:

  1. Fixed an issue where saving a new character would show an "unsaved changes" error

  2. Fixed an issue where dirty flags could not be properly removed for new categories in the Exchange Editor

  3. Adjusted the current mod editing workflow:

    • There are now two core data modes: Pure Core Data mode and Core Data with Loaded Mods mode, for easier editing and reference.

    • Mod editing mode change: When editing a mod, only Core Data and that mod's data are used, data is no longer polluted by other loaded mods.

    • Separated the in-game mod load list from the Mod Editor's editing mode, mods can now be edited without loading them first.

  4. Added buffs/debuffs that existed in the engine but were not shown in the list.
